
Ave Maria Pre and Primary School Celebrates Standard Seven Graduation Ceremony
Ave Maria Pre and Primary School proudly held a colorful and memorable Standard Seven Graduation Ceremony, marking an important milestone in the academic journey of its pupils. The event was a moment of joy, pride, and reflection for pupils, parents, teachers, and the entire school community.
The ceremony was graced by the presence of the Guest of Honor, the Acting Regional Primary Education Officer of Geita Region, whose attendance added great value and significance to the occasion. The Guest of Honor commended the school for its commitment to quality education and its contribution to the development of education standards within Geita Region.
During the event, graduating pupils showcased various performances including songs, poems, and presentations that reflected their academic growth, discipline, and confidence developed throughout their years at the school. The performances were warmly received by parents and invited guests, creating a lively and inspiring atmosphere.
In his speech, the Guest of Honor encouraged the graduates to remain disciplined, focused, and committed to their studies as they prepare to join secondary education. He also emphasized the importance of hard work, good morals, and respect for teachers and parents as key pillars for future success. Furthermore, he applauded Ave Maria Pre and Primary School for integrating international languages and vocational skills into its learning programs, aligning education with both national and global demands.
The school leadership, led by Mr. Sweetbert A. Bushesha, the Director General and School Owner, expressed gratitude to parents, teachers, and stakeholders for their continued support. He reaffirmed the school’s mission to provide holistic education that combines academic excellence, moral values, practical skills, and inclusiveness. Special appreciation was also extended to the teaching staff for their dedication and professionalism in nurturing learners.
The graduation ceremony also highlighted the school’s Free Education Sponsorship Program, which supports orphans and children from vulnerable backgrounds. This initiative reflects the school’s strong commitment to social responsibility and equal access to quality education.
Parents and guardians expressed their satisfaction with the academic progress and positive transformation they have witnessed in their children. Many praised the school for its supportive learning environment, strong leadership, and emphasis on both academic and character development.
The event concluded with the awarding of certificates to the graduating pupils, followed by group photos and celebrations. The Standard Seven Graduation Ceremony stood as a true reflection of Ave Maria Pre and Primary School’s dedication to educating minds and transforming lives.
